Students who have difficulty in Mathematics can be classified as dyscalculia. The type of difficulty Mathematics (dyscalculia) actually consists of a combination of dyslexia and increment. Akalkulia refers to the problem faced by children who cannot perform operations involving numbers and mathematical symbols. Therefore, this study focuses on the use of the Game Cards as a tool and material to help increase the mastery of addition concepts among dyscalculia pupils. The population of study is Year 6 Cempaka students from the Sekolah Program Pendidikan Khas Integrasi (PPKI) Sekolah Kebangsaaan Pekan Beaufort, Sabah. Four pupils from the population were taken as samples in this study. This study is a Action Research which uses qualitative design research types. The data collection method used is the collection of pre-post test scores, observations and document analysis of pupils’ answers. The results of the analysis show that the use of the Game Cards has a positive impact on the ability to master of addition concepts among pupils on the effectiveness of teaching and learning sessions in theclassroom.
